Nancy Dawkins is a force to be reckoned with, a walking legacy who does not take no for an answer, and the wittiest 96-year old I know! She is a community activist, an education advocate, Liberty City pioneer, and one of my most favorite people! She along with her late husband, Miller Dawkins, who served as a City of Miami Commissioner for years, moved into their Liberty City home over 60 years ago. Since then, Mrs. Dawkins has worked tirelessly to make her community a better place.
